Abstract
MongoDB is an open source NoSQL database written in C++ with support for dynamic schemas. MongoDB stores documents in JSON-like format called BSON. BSON supports embedding of objects and arrays within other arrays and objects. BSON is lightweight, traversable, and efficient. While MongoDB offers some of the same advantages offered by Couchbase, it also has some limitations. Couchbase has the following advantages over MongoDB.
